Location
The hotel is about 10 km from Benito Juarez International airport and just a minute's drive from such cultural venues as Monument to the Revolution. Located about a 5-minute walk from Hidalgo underground station, the accommodation is approximately a 25-minute walk from the famous Angel of Independence Monument. Estanquillo Museum is merely 1.3 km away, while Buenavista is situated within walking distance of this Mexico City hotel.
Paseo de la Reforma bus stop is only 10 minutes' walk from the property.
